Biography

Ayako Suga is a member of the Firm's IP Tech group in Tokyo. Ayako is a native Japanese speaker and is fluent in English.

Practice Focus

Ayako focuses her practice on domestic and international IP protection, transactions and dispute resolution, data protection and utilization and IT business. She is particularly experienced in the negotiation and drafting of contracts for IP clearance in cross-border transactions and IT services.

Representative Legal Matters

Intellectual Property

  • Researched the trade secret protection legal regimes of seven countries - including Japan - and reported the results as part of the Ministry of Economy, Trade and Industry's "2014 commissioned industrial and economic project (research and study regarding trade secret protection)."
  • Negotiated and drafted a wide array of domestic and cross-border IP agreements related to licensing, co-development, technology transfer, outsourcing of manufacturing and sales, franchising, IP assignment, software licensing and entertainment, etc.
  • Performed IP due diligence for several M&A transactions.
  • Advised on domestic and international trademark applications and appeals challenging examiner decisions on rejection, cancellation for non-use, co-existence agreements and other procedures and on anti-counterfeiting measures.
  • Represented a US company in patent litigation against a Japanese company.

Information Technology

  • Negotiated and drafted agreements related to B2B IT services and drafted terms of use and privacy policies for B2C IT services and internal IT policies.
  • Advised on personal data protection, consumer protection, telecommunications, virtual currencies, gambling, expression and other regulations in relation to the global launch of online games.
  • Advised on the protection of customer data by financial institutions.
  • Advised on the Act against Unjustifiable Premiums and Misleading Representations and other regulations in relation to advertising campaigns.
